---@param base_path string
---@param workspace_patterns string[]
---@return string[]
---Resolve workspace patterns to actual directories containing package.json
---Supports glob patterns: *, **, ?, [...]
local function resolve_workspace_paths(base_path, workspace_patterns)
local resolved = {}
local seen = {}

for _, pattern in ipairs(workspace_patterns) do
local glob_path = vim.fs.joinpath(base_path, pattern)
local matches = vim.fn.glob(glob_path, false, true)
if type(matches) == "string" then
matches = { matches }
elseif not matches or vim.tbl_isempty(matches) then
goto continue
end

for _, match in ipairs(matches) do
local package_json_path = vim.fs.joinpath(match, "package.json")
if vim.uv.fs_stat(package_json_path) and not seen[match] then
table.insert(resolved, match)
seen[match] = true
end
end

::continue::
end
return "npm"

return resolved
end

---@param bin string
---@param workspace_paths string[]
---@return table[]
local function add_workspace_tasks(bin, workspace_paths)
local tasks = {}

for _, workspace_path in ipairs(workspace_paths) do
local workspace_package_file = vim.fs.joinpath(workspace_path, "package.json")
local workspace_data = files.load_json_file(workspace_package_file)
if workspace_data and workspace_data.scripts then
for k in pairs(workspace_data.scripts) do
table.insert(tasks, {
name = string.format("%s[workspace] %s (%s)", bin, k, workspace_data.name),
builder = function()
return {
cmd = { bin, "run", k },
cwd = workspace_path,
}
end,
})
end
end
end

return tasks
end

---@param content string
---@return table|nil
local function parse_pnpm_workspace_regex(content)
local inclusions, exclusions = {}, {}

local in_packages = false
for line in content:gmatch("[^\n]+") do
-- Check if we're entering the packages block
if line:match("^packages%s*:") then
in_packages = true

-- Check if we're leaving the packages block (key at same indentation level)
elseif in_packages and line:match("^%w+%s*:") and not line:match("^%s+%-") then
in_packages = false

-- If we're in the packages block, parse the patterns
elseif in_packages then
-- Match lines like " - 'pattern'" or " - \"pattern\""
local pattern = line:match("%-[%s]*['\"]([^'\"]+)['\"]")
if pattern then
if pattern:sub(1, 1) == "!" then
table.insert(exclusions, pattern:sub(2))
else
table.insert(inclusions, pattern)
end
end
end
end

if #inclusions > 0 then
return { inclusions = inclusions }
end

return nil
end
